Nothing greets guests like a 4 foot tall planter in the shape of your last name. Monograms are all the rage and if you’re looking for a way to add interest to the exterior entry of your home, look no further than this awesome DIY Cedar Monogram Planter Box by Michelle at www.ellerydesigns.com.

As she points out in her very detailed how-to, the possibilities of year-round décor don’t end, but even if you keep it simple with plants alone, you can’t go wrong!

This how-to calls for cedar wood (1X12 cedar for back of letter; 1X4 cedar for the sides; 1X3 cedar for the front; 1X6 cedar for the planter slats), 18 gauge 1 ¾ brad nails and a nail gun, gorilla glue, compound miter saw, potting mix, flowers, and maybe even someone handy with a saw.
